Update to Meteohub V4.6t (NSLU2, x86, SheevaPlug) brings these features:
  • improvement on Vantage logger process, fixes situations where data logger gets stalled.
  • new variable "actual_thb*_fc_vpicon" which reflects field 89 of Vantage LOOP packet
  • support for new weather network "meteonews" is now up and running
  • supports daisy-chained Meteohubs with a Vantage connected to the first Meteohub in the queue (was broken since 4.6r)
  • removes option for updates by selecting a file to be uploaded from the browsing pc (update web) as this does not work properly for larger packages.
